Hello which one do you recommend the t40 or the t38. I seen on comments of a different video you said you thought the t40 was superior. Then i seen on same video 3 weeks ago that you like the t38 better and have the t40 up for sale? Also is it very hard to stand in the t38? Thanks
@ryanferris7841
Ай бұрын
Hi, thanks for your comment, the t40 is the more superior boat but only slightly!! Cons - weight and its sheer size noise from the floor and in my opinion requires a trailer hard to manage alone hard to get small stones and shells that gather under the floor!! Pros- floor space stability and a flat safe surface for standing on After using the t38 more i actually prefer it and I can stand up in it no problem it’s so easy to manage and overall a more versatile sib faster too and handles better it’s sporty feeling I have now sold my t40 so I now would recommend the t38
